[GitHub] mesos issue #190: Ensure curl is present on Ubuntu

2016-11-29 Thread jieyu
Github user jieyu commented on the issue:

https://github.com/apache/mesos/pull/190
  
Yeah, curl currently is a dependency if people wants to use container image 
support in unified containerizer. There is plan to remove this dependency.
